If you are looking for a multi-functional car key cutting machine, look into the Gymkana 994 from Keyline USA. It has a universal, self-aligning clamp that can be used to cut or decode the majority of edge-cutting keys with a double-sided laser. It can be used with other clamps, such as the V clamp for Volkswagen Laser Keys, including the four-sided ones as well as the H clamp to cut 6-cut Tibbe System. It can also be used with residential, commercial, and single-sided automotive keys.
Another popular choice is the Silca Futura Pro Auto, which is able to cut standard keys and OE key fobs. It has an accessory tray built in and LED lights that indicate the state of the keys. The LED lights change from white to yellow and then green when the key's ready to cut. The shortcut function allows for the quick search for keys.

Contrary to traditional mechanical keys modern keys utilize transponder chips to transmit data over radio frequency transmissions. The car's onboard computer system detects the data and allows the vehicle to be started. Although most modern vehicles can be started with these keys, it is necessary to have a transponder key programmer to program the new keys for the vehicle. It is a small handheld device that transmits the information to the onboard computer of the vehicle.
